HB 1011, the Daren Lewis Saving Lives Act, is a Georgia bill currently in early legislative stages (House First and Second Readers). Based on the bill's title referencing a specific individual and "saving lives," it likely addresses a public safety issue, though the full text and specific provisions are not publicly detailed in the information provided.
Bills named after individuals often commemorate tragic incidents and respond to systemic gaps in public safety or health policy. If this follows that pattern, it could establish new protocols, funding, or accountability measures affecting Georgia residents. The bill's progression through readers suggests it has sponsor support and may advance further in the legislative session.
